Gendering Smart Mobilities
"This book considers gender perspectives on the implementation of digital technologies and smart solutions to effectively provide 'mobility for all' in urban spaces. It does so while attending to the agenda of creating green and inclusive cities. It deals with the conceptualization, design, planning and execution of these fast emerging 'smart' solutions. The volume questions the efficacy of transformations being brought by smart solutions and highlights the need for a more robust problem formulation to guide the design of smart solutions and further maps out the need for stronger governance...
